46th (Belfast) Company
The 46th (Belfast) Company (otherwise known as the 1st Belfast Company, or A (Belfast) Company), comprising two officers and 116 men, sailed from Dublin for England on board the s.s. Cambrai on 2 March 1900, together with the 54th (Belfast) Company. The following day they sailed from Albert Docks, London, on board the s.s. Cornwall arriving in Capetown on 28 March. The Company left South Africa on board the s.s. Mongolian on 8 May 1901.
Their regimental numbers ran from 9361 to 9476 and 9596-9600.
